The man who witnessed the arrest and killing of George Floyd is now speaking out to share what was running through his mind in those heartbreaking moments. He’s also demanding justice Floyd, who was only 46-year-old.

As we previously reported, Floyd died after a Minneapolis police officer Derek Chauvin detained on suspicion of forgery. Chauvin placed his knee on Floyd’s neck and cut off his airway, leaving him unconscious. He was later pronounced dead at a local hospital.

Many witnesses including Donald Williams can be heard pleading with cops to get off of Floyd. However, they completely ignored their pleas. Williams recently appeared on CNN where he got emotional while speaking to anchor Chris Cuomo about Floyd’s final moments.

The four officers involved in the incident have all been fired. However, that is not enough. Many people are now calling for all the officers to be arrested and charged for the death of Floyd.

According to the latest update, prosecutors now say they had called in the FBI to help investigate the case, which could involve a federal felony civil rights violation.
